**Step-by-Step Solution for Rosenmund's Reaction:** 1. **Understanding the Reactants:** - Identify the starting material, which is an acid chloride (RCOCl). Acid chlorides are derivatives of carboxylic acids where the hydroxyl group (-OH) is replaced by a chlorine atom. 2. **Reaction Conditions:** - The reaction is carried out in the presence of hydrogen gas (H2) and a catalyst, which is palladium (Pd) supported on barium sulfate (BaSO4). This specific catalyst is crucial as it allows for the selective reduction of the acid chloride to an aldehyde. ...
